Quote:
Originally Posted by ownedbycats View Post
EDIT: Actually -- is there an option to have FFF generate an epub structure for 15 chapters, but leave the content blank? That would make 'saving and compiling the ebook manually' a bit easier.
No, FFF doesn't have such a feature; it's not really in scope. But if you're already poking at code, you can pretty trivially change adapter_test1 to do that for you.

Actually, you may want to look at the adapter_test1 teststory settings and modify that rather than the site adapter.
